Job description

This is an exciting opportunity for an experienced professional Credit Administrator to join a dynamic and fast-paced office environment on a permanent contract for one year. The ideal candidate will have strong computer literacy, excellent attention to detail, and the ability to manage credit and collections processes effectively. If you have the required experience and skills, we encourage you to apply.

Pay: $67,800 - $70,000

R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Oversees account collection process and engages external agencies
  • Initiates and assesses creditworthiness of new customers
  • Communicates with credit/collection agencies for solvency information
  • Collaborates with Sales to optimize collection strategies
  • Monitors denunciation projects and ensures complete documentation
  • Obtains bond guarantees and issues discharges/releases as needed
  • Generates accounts receivable reports and statistical reports
  • Evaluates and recommends improvements to credit and collection policies
  • Assesses the need for legal action on problematic accounts
  • Screens and responds to calls and correspondence, handles general inquiries
  • Provides administrative support for the region
  • Reviews return to vendor processes and verifies credits
  • Audits shipping orders, communicates errors, and suggests improvements
  • Organizes and maintains region office records and files
  • Assists with credit approvals, invoice adjustments, and updates to Accounts
  • Receivable and Accounts Payable
  • Supports Purchasing Supervisor in maintaining purchasing reports
  • Researches, receives, and files Mill Test Reports (MTRs)
  • Manages office inventory and orders supplies as needed
  • Processes and documents cash sales, reconciles cash, and receipts
  • Other duties as assigned

QUALIFICATIONS:

  • College Diploma in Finance, Business, Accounting, or a related discipline
  • Enrollment in Certified Credit Professional (CCP) program with Credit Institute of Canada
  • Minimum two (2) years of experience in credit management, preferably with progressive levels of responsibility
  • A combination of education and experience
  • Fluently Bilingual in French and English
  • Extensive knowledge of credit and legal context related to the construction industry
  • Excellent verbal and written communication, and interpersonal skills
  • Solid organizational skills with the ability to multitask and prioritize
  • High degree of accuracy with attention to detail
  • Computer literacy
  • Experience with property liens or Pre-liens for construction jobs
